网页授权机制有哪些常见的应用场景?

网页授权机制在多个场景中都有广泛应用,以下是一些常见的应用场景:

  • 社交媒体登录:用户可以使用社交媒体账户(如微信、微博等)登录第三方网站,无需重新创建账户。
  • 单点登录(SSO):允许用户在一次登录后访问多个相关应用,提高用户体验。
  • 数据共享:在用户授权的情况下,不同应用之间可以共享用户数据,实现更个性化的服务。

具体应用场景示例

  • 微信网页授权:用户在微信客户端中访问第三方网页时,公众号可以通过微信网页授权机制获取用户基本信息,进而实现业务逻辑。
  • 第三方应用登录:用户在第三方应用中登录时,应用可以通过网页授权机制获取用户在社交平台上的信息,简化登录流程。
  • 跨应用跳转:在用户同意授权后,应用可以获取用户的授权码,实现从应用A跳转到应用B的功能。

应用场景的技术实现

  • 微信网页授权流程:用户同意授权后获取code,通过code换取网页授权access_token,然后使用access_token获取用户信息。
  • 网页授权与单点登录的结合:通过网页授权机制,实现用户在多个应用间的无缝切换,提高用户体验。

通过这些应用场景和技术实现,网页授权机制不仅简化了用户的登录过程,还增强了数据的安全性,因为用户的密码不会直接传递给第三方应用。

0 条评论

还没有人发表评论

发表评论 取消回复

记住我的信息,方便下次评论
有人回复时邮件通知我